Fuses can be inspected visually (if it has a clear housing) - just remove the fuse and look for a thin wire running in the middle. If the wire is continous, no breaks - then the fuse is ok and there's something else that's wrong.
If you see a broken wire, then the fuse is blown - just replace it and hopefully that's the only issue (it usually is)
